5.0 out of 5 stars Coleman Cables 14/3, 100 ft = NOT for the Toro 1800 Power Curve Snow Thrower (#38381), December 7, 2010
This review is from: Coleman Cable 02469 14/3 SJTW Low-Temp Outdoor Extension Cord with Lighted End, 100-Foot (Tools & Home Improvement)
Toro 18-Inch Electric 1800 Power Curve Snow Thrower (#38381) = 15 Amp motor

Coleman Cables Low-Temp Outdoor Extension Cord Amp Ratings (from the manufacturer):
Coleman Cables 12/3, 50 ft = 15 Amp
Coleman Cables 12/3, 100 ft = 15 Amp
Coleman Cables 14/3, 25 ft = 15 Amp
Coleman Cables 14/3, 50 ft = 15 Amp
Coleman Cables 14/3, 100 ft = 13 Amp ***

***13 Amps IS NOT ENOUGH for the Toro Power Curve Snow Thrower (#38381), creating a FIRE HAZARD.

I hope that this information helps to prevent any future fires and frustration to keep everyone safe this winter season.

1.0 out of 5 stars Don't use with Toro 1800 (38381) Power Curve Snow Thrower, November 11, 2010
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Coleman Cable 02469 14/3 SJTW Low-Temp Outdoor Extension Cord with Lighted End, 100-Foot (Tools & Home Improvement)
Check before you buy the Coleman Cable 02469 14/3 SJTW Low-Temp Outdoor Extension Cord with Lighted End, 100-Foot for uses with the Toro 1800 (38381) Power Curve Snow Thrower as recommended by Amazon. The 100' Extension Cord is rated at 13amps and the blower is rated at 15amps, so the cord may or may not handle the load of this blower. That maybe the reason for some of the fires that have been reported with this cable. The 50' Coleman Cable is rated at 15amps so it seems to be the right one for this blower.
